{"data":{"id":"us-nh/rsa-266-55","jurisdiction":"us-nh","citation":"RSA 266:55","heading":"Mirrors.","body":"No person shall drive upon any way any closed motor vehicle, or motor vehicle so constructed, equipped, or loaded that the driver is prevented from having a constantly free and unobstructed view of the way immediately in the rear, unless there is attached to the vehicle a mirror or reflector so placed and adjusted as to afford the driver a clear, reflected view of the way in the rear of the vehicle.","path":["Title XXI: MOTOR VEHICLES","Chapter 266: EQUIPMENT OF VEHICLES","Miscellaneous"],"source_url":"https://gc.nh.gov/rsa/html/XXI/266/266-55.htm","current_through":"2025 regular legislative session, or December 2025","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-05T14:36:09Z","sha256":"6d0cd7b57248bffa784ae75c82208b98da3ee0fefd1159d012f3d18f96c39601","source_id":"us-nh","stale":false,"prev":"us-nh/rsa-266-54","next":"us-nh/rsa-266-56"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
